## Authentication

The Ravelstack ORM refactor splits reads onto the new mapper while writes stay on legacy paths. Both paths share one auth flow: requests hit the internal token broker, which validates scope before query dispatch. Integration tests need broker access. Use the key below when running the suite locally.

service key, bajog-yahop: kto7_mMHVCpJ

## Runbook: GraphQL N+1 Fix — Orvano Catalog Service

This release adds a dataloader batching layer to the Orvano catalog resolver, eliminating the per-item vendor lookups. Verify query counts drop below 10 per request on the staging dashboard before promoting. Confirm cache TTLs match production config. After verification, sign the deploy manifest with the key below.

deploy key for kajof-fajop: bky6_gDHw9Q

Title: resizer chokes on folders with more than 10k images

The Shrinkly batch CLI hangs partway through large directories — looks like it loads every file handle up front instead of streaming. Easy to reproduce: point it at a big folder and watch memory climb until the OS kills it. Probably needs chunked processing. Good starter ticket if you want to learn the pipeline code. Reproduced on the build noted below.

pipeline stamp: htk4_ae36

QUARTERLY PLANNING NOTE — Sales Leads

We are retiring the Fenbrook Classic line at the end of Q2. No new orders after the cutoff; existing commitments will be honoured through fulfilment. Steer active deals toward the Fenbrook Apex range — trade-in incentives apply until June. Comp plans adjust accordingly; details from Marta Hollis next week. Do not announce to accounts until the transition kit ships. The reasoning behind the timing follows below.

management briefing: Jorixax Holdings is in early talks to buy Casixax Holdings for about $420.3 million. The Fenmir launch date is October 27, and nothing goes to the press before then. Legal wants the Keloxek Foods term sheet redrafted before April 16.